What achievements did the civilizations of the Middle Ages become famous for? Europe: Italy, England, France, Germany.

The Middle Ages of European countries are considered “dark”. This is a period of poor development in the field of science, medicine, culture. Also, in the Middle Ages, the spread of various diseases flourished, which destroyed entire cities. But there were also achievements. This is the development of industry, the introduction of machine tools to facilitate the work of people, the invention of the printing press, some advances in the study of human anatomy. The Middle Ages are also characterized by the wars of European countries. All these wars were mainly of a religious nature.
